DEVELOPMENT UPDATE: Digital Network Expands Coverage in Northern Bahr el Ghazal
A new phase in digital connectivity has been recorded in South Sudan as the Digital Network officially begins operations in key locations within Aweil and surrounding areas.
The service is now fully active in Aweil Town, Bar Mayen Payam (Aweil Centre County), and Malek Alel Town (Aweil South County), enabling residents in these areas to access mobile communication services.
According to implementation updates, the network provider is also preparing further expansion into additional towns, including Wanyjok (Aweil East County), Nyamlel (Aweil West County), and Gok Machar (Aweil North County).
The rollout is part of ongoing efforts to improve digital connectivity in the region. Digital Network has been gaining popularity across South Sudan, largely due to its relatively affordable tariffs and improving service reliability, making it an increasingly preferred option for communication among users.

Mandinka moral story

“At this certain time, in a certain
village, lived this certain person.” It was a small boy who walked to the riverbank oneday and found a crocodile trapped in a net.
“Help me!” the crocodile cried out.
“You’ll kill me!” cried the boy.
“No! Come nearer!” said the crocodile.
So the boy went up to the crocodile—and instantly was
seized by the teeth in that long mouth.
“Is this how you repay my goodness—with badness?”
cried the boy.
“Of course,” said the crocodile out of the corner of his mouth. “That is the way of the world.”
The boy refused to believe that, so the crocodile agreednot to swallow him without getting an opinion from the firstthree witnesses to pass by.
First was an old donkey. When the boy asked his opinion, the donkey said, “Nowthat I’m old and can no longer work, my master has driven me out for the leopards to get me!”
“See?” said the crocodile. Next to pass by was an oldhorse, who had the same opinion.
“See?” said the crocodile.
Then along came a plumprabbit who said, “Well, I can’t give a good opinion withoutseeing this matter as it happened from the beginning.” Grumbling, the crocodile opened his mouth to tell him—and the boy jumped out to safety on the riverbank.
“Do you like crocodile meat?” asked the rabbit.
The boysaid yes. “And do your parents?” He said yes again. “Then
here is a crocodile ready for the pot.”
The boy ran off and returned with the men of the village, who helped him to kill the crocodile. But they brought withthem a wuolo dog, which chased and caught and killed therabbit, too.
“So the crocodile was right,” said Nyo Boto. “It is the wayof the world that goodness is often repaid with badness".
